Why These Wheels Fit

Wheel interchange depends on more than bolt pattern. Where data is available, this site compares:

  • Bolt pattern / PCD
  • Center bore direction (donor wheel bore must not be smaller than the hub)
  • Wheel diameter, width, and offset against known OEM ranges
  • Lug thread / hardware differences (vehicle-side hardware)

A normal wheel spacer does not change bolt pattern. Hub rings cannot enlarge a wheel bore that is smaller than the hub. Brake clearance and tire package fitment still require vehicle-specific checks when not confirmed in the dataset.

Known OEM Fitment For 2012 Dodge Avenger

The values below represent factory specifications for at least one trim of the 2012 Dodge Avenger. Other trims or appearance packages may differ. If your trim is different or unknown, confirm using the on-page calculator and your owner’s manual or OEM parts catalog before purchasing.

Bolt pattern 5x114.3 mm (also written as 5x4.5 in)
Center bore 67.1 mm
Thread size M12 x 1.5
OEM rim diameter 16 in
OEM rim width 7.0 in
OEM wheel offset ET 40 mm
Backspacing 5.07 in
OEM tire size 215/65R16

Use these as your starting point when comparing other wheels and tires for interchangeability.

Fitment Checklist Before You Buy

  • Bolt pattern: Must match 5x114.3 exactly. Do not rely on wobble or offset studs.
  • Center bore: Vehicle is 67.1 mm. Larger is acceptable with quality hub centric rings. Smaller will not fit.
  • Thread and seat: Threads are M12 x 1.5. Verify the lug nut seat type required by your wheels (commonly 60 degree conical, but confirm with the wheel manufacturer). Do not mix seat styles.
  • Offset and backspacing: Compare against OEM ET 40 mm and 5.07 in backspacing in the calculator. Ensure adequate inner clearance to struts and brake lines, and avoid excessive outer poke into the fender or bumper liner.
  • Brake clearance: Visually check spoke and barrel clearance over calipers and rotors. Some wheel designs with the same specs may still interfere.
  • Tire dimensions: Check overall diameter and section width. Confirm clearance at full steering lock, through suspension travel, and with passengers or cargo.
  • Load rating: Wheels and tires must meet or exceed the vehicle’s OEM load rating. Check sidewall markings and wheel manufacturer data.
  • TPMS: If equipped, plan to transfer or replace TPMS sensors and perform relearn as required.
  • Spare fitment: If you change overall diameter significantly, verify that your spare and jack points remain usable.

Plus Sizing And Common Upgrades

Plus sizing keeps overall tire diameter close to stock while changing rim diameter and tire profile. Use the calculator to model the examples below and verify clearances before purchase.

  • Plus 0: Stay with 16 in wheels. You can adjust tire width or aspect ratio slightly to fine tune look and grip while keeping diameter similar.
  • Plus 1: Move to a 17 in wheel. Select a lower tire aspect ratio to maintain overall diameter. Confirm offset, brake clearance, and fender space.
  • Plus 2: Move to an 18 in wheel. Use a lower-profile tire and verify clearance at full lock and over bumps.

Every wheel design is different. Two wheels with the same width and offset can clear brakes differently due to spoke shape and barrel profile, so always perform a test-fit.

Installation Tips

  • Test-fit each wheel on the hub without a tire first. Confirm center bore fit, stud engagement, and caliper clearance.
  • Clean the hub face and the wheel mounting pad to bare metal. Remove rust and debris to prevent runout and vibration.
  • If using hub centric rings, ensure they are fully seated in the wheel and match 67.1 mm at the hub. Do not stack rings.
  • Hand thread all lug nuts. Tighten in a star pattern in multiple passes using a calibrated torque wrench. Use only the torque spec from your owner’s manual or OEM service information.
  • Re-torque after 50 to 100 miles on new wheels or when temperatures change significantly.
  • Verify tire rotation direction and inside-outside orientation before inflating to the door-jamb placard pressure.
  • If equipped with TPMS, follow the relearn procedure for your vehicle and verify the light is off after driving.

FAQs

  • What is the bolt pattern for the 2012 Dodge Avenger?

    5x114.3 mm, also written as 5x4.5 in. The wheel must match this pattern exactly.

  • Can I use 5x115 wheels on a 5x114.3 hub?

    No. Mixing bolt patterns is unsafe and can cause stud stress, vibration, and loss of clamping force. Use only 5x114.3 wheels.

  • Do I need hub centric rings?

    If your aftermarket wheel center bore is larger than 67.1 mm, use rings sized to 67.1 mm at the hub and the wheel’s bore on the outer side. If the wheel bore is 67.1 mm already, rings are not needed.

  • What lug nuts does the Avenger use?

    The thread is M12 x 1.5. The required seat type and length depend on the wheel design. Confirm with the wheel manufacturer and match the seat style exactly.

  • What offset range works on this car?

    OEM offset is ET 40 mm. Acceptable changes depend on wheel width and design. Use the calculator to compare inner and outer clearances, then perform a physical test-fit.

  • Will larger wheels affect my speedometer or ABS?

    Yes if overall tire diameter changes significantly. Use the calculator to keep diameter close to stock and verify with a GPS speed check after installation.

  • What tire pressure should I run?

    Use the pressure on the driver door-jamb placard for your tire size and load. If you change sizes, consult a tire professional and do not exceed the tire’s maximum pressure rating.
